f.51: 'Mr Leman, you are desired to pay the bearer, Henry Kinge, a poor soldier late sick of the smallpox, one week’s pay, being four shillings and eight pence, to carry him to his colours under Major Holmes; and for your so doing this shall be your warrant. Dated the 15 of May 1644.'
Record of payment
- Parliamentary Committee for the Eastern Association, Cambridgeshire, 15 May 1644
